Hello guys!:) I'm absolutely belated to have found this wonderful site! Recently, I have had a virus which I believe to be related to VUNDO; as it has come up in many virus scans I have made. For now, all I know of to do is run a virus scan, and post a HJT log. Some of the measures I had resorted to were, removing Avast after it failed to detect the virus, and purchased NOD 32. After doing so, I had noticed, NOD 32, after running a full system scan, had detected a large amount of virus' or infections, around 1,000. After removing them, the virus seemed to still be there. I then had one of my "techy-friends" remove some potentially harmful registry keys. In doing so, some of my very annoying errors stopped showing. As I logged onto my Windows XP Home Edition account, I received errors such as "insert .dll here" is not a valid windows image. Now I'm getting continuous pop-ups and I have no idea what to do. "-> No action taken."

Means you missed a step in the instructions:

# When the scan is complete, click OK, then Show Results to view the results.
# Be sure that everything is checked, and click Remove Selected.

So run MBAM again and this time do the above.

OTL.Txt and Extras.Txt should be in the same place as the OTL.exe program. Usually on the desktop.

Vundo has about 5 different programs running so you have to kill all of them at the same time which is why HJT doesn't help.
